This paper presents an Integrated Emergency Management System (IEMS) for hazardous materials (HM) transport, by introducing a theory of risk control and management. The proposed system is composed of three sub-systems including the Risk Monitoring Platform (RMP) for transport companies, the On-board Monitoring System (OMS) for vehicles and drivers, and the Emergency Response System (ERS) for the Emergency Response Coordination Center (ERCC). The system is developed in order to tackle the current issue of insufficient sharing of information among the three parties (i.e. transport companies, drivers and government). This proposed system makes it possible to reduce risk during HM transport and provides technical support for emergency response to HM accidents occurred on roadways.
